Ethel Louise Benoit, age 85, passed away Tuesday, January 26, 2010, at her home in Brenham, TX. Louise turned 85 on December 12, 2009, and had been struggling with Parkinson Disease.

She had lived in Lake Charles for more than 60 years before moving to Brenham to live with her only living sibling and beloved brother, Paul, and his wife, Ada.

Louise will be remembered for her career in banking and years in the Calcasieu Parish Tax Assessors' Office from which she retired. She was a member of the American Legion Auxiliary and St. Margaret's Catholic Church and V.I.C. Group.

Louise and her husband, Paul, loved to travel and had many photo albums from those trips.

Anyone who knew Louise knew about her love for cats. She had a black and white cat named Sox, who loved her like no other.

Louise was lovingly cared for by Brazos Valley Hospice, 302 East Bluebell Road, Brenham, TX, 77833-2406.

In lieu of flowers, family requests that donations be made to them. Louise would greatly appreciate that.

Preceding her in death was her dear husband of 60 years, Paul H. Benoit.

Survivors include her brother, Paul M. Fulton and wife, Ada of Brenham, TX; nieces, Claire, Cam, and Paula; great nieces, Cathe and Amy and her husband, Aaron; and a great-great-grandniece, Crysta.

Her funeral service will be held at 11 a.m. on Saturday, January 30, 2010, at Johnson Funeral Home. Deacon Dan Landry will officiate.

Burial will follow in Consolata Cemetery.
